About North Augusta Elementary

North Augusta Elementary is a public elementary school in North Augusta, SC, part of Aiken 01. North Augusta Elementary serves approximately 652 students, and covers grades Pre-K-5th, and has a 13.9:1 student-teacher ratio. North Augusta Elementary has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.3 out of 10 and ranks #576 of 1,176 schools in SC.

Structured state assessment records for North Augusta Elementary show 60%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 60%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about North Augusta Elementary

What grades does North Augusta Elementary serve?

North Augusta Elementary serves students in grades Pre-K through 5th.

How many students attend North Augusta Elementary?

North Augusta Elementary has an enrollment of approximately 652 students.

What is the student-teacher ratio at North Augusta Elementary?

The student-teacher ratio at North Augusta Elementary is 13.9:1.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student. The national average is approximately 16:1 for public schools.

How does North Augusta Elementary rank in SC?

North Augusta Elementary ranks #576 of 1,176 schools in SC.

What is North Augusta Elementary's MySchoolScout rating?

North Augusta Elementary has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.3 out of 10. This score combines the level-appropriate components shown in the rating breakdown; equity data is shown separately for context.

What are the test scores at North Augusta Elementary?

Based on loaded state assessment records, North Augusta Elementary has 60%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 60%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

Is North Augusta Elementary a charter school?

No, North Augusta Elementary is not a charter school. It is a traditional public school operated by the local school district.

Is North Augusta Elementary a Title I school?

No, North Augusta Elementary is not currently a Title I school.

What does the Free & Reduced Lunch percentage mean for North Augusta Elementary?

58.0% of students at North Augusta Elementary q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. This is a commonly used indicator of economic need and provides important context when interpreting test scores.
